## Log sampling — Chattermill ingest service

Chattermill emits roughly 40k lines per minute at steady state, so we sample before shipping to the audit sink. Error and security-relevant events bypass sampling entirely; only informational traffic is reduced. Sampling decisions are deterministic per request ID to keep traces reconstructable. The active sampling configuration on the ingest tier is as follows.

service settings:
PRAIX_LOG_LEVEL=error
PRAIX_METRICS_HOST=metrics.praix.qorvelcorp.corp
PRAIX_POOL_SIZE=16

Action item: The Relayn deploy-status bot silently dropped updates when the pipeline API paginated results, so responders believed a rollback had completed when it had not. We will add pagination handling, a staleness banner, and an integration test. Until merged, verify deploy state directly in the pipeline console, documented at the page below.

runbook for kahop-kajop: https://rundeck.ordinio.test/display/secrets/pipeline/issue/pages/repo/browse/e5732776e07d1285107e5aeb

Support staff can confirm this by calling the internal `/resolve-trace` endpoint on the Pathcheck service, which replays the lookup with full timing detail. Note that `/resolve-trace` is authenticated separately from the public API, and anonymous calls return an empty trace. Authenticate each request using the key provided below.

API key for yahig-tadup: kto7_ubizbYm

Subject: After-hours server room access — please read

Hello new starters,

Welcome to Briarfold Systems. If you need the Level 3 server room outside 08:00–18:00, you must first log your visit in the facilities book at the front desk and notify the on-call engineer. Tailgating is strictly prohibited, and the door must latch fully behind you. The after-hours keypad code is as follows.

door code, kawip-bagap: bdg-HQEWH-4

Subject: Billing worker cut-over complete

The Ledgerfox billing worker moved to blue-green last night. Green took full traffic at 02:10; blue was retired after a clean two-hour soak. No failed charges, no duplicate invoices. Rollback path remains available for 72 hours. For your review, the green environment's configuration values are below.

config for yawep-tajef:
[kelion]
team = kelys
access_code = ac_1a130d
owner = holax.aldmir
host = kelion.urlaqforge.example
port = 9090
peer = fenmir.lumicio.example
salt = d0dd3cb5
pin = 3295